Aug 17 (Reuters) - Canadian gold and copper producer OceanaGold (OGC.TO), plans to acquire Australia's Ausgold (AUC.AX), in a deal valued at A$776 million ($552.74 million), the companies said on Monday.
Here are some details:
The deal represents a premium of 27.7% to Ausgold's previous close on Friday and gives OceanaGold ownership of the Katanning project in Western Australia.
Trading in Ausgold's shares was halted earlier in the day ahead of the announcement.
Ausgold shareholders will own about 6% to 8% of OceanaGold upon completion of the deal.
"This marks our first acquisition in Australia, and we are excited to build on the great work done by the Ausgold team to further optimize the development of the Katanning Gold Project for the benefit of both OceanaGold and Ausgold shareholders," OceanaGold CEO Gerard Bond said.
($1 = 1.4039 Australian dollars)
